What Actually Drives Garage Door Pricing
The first thing to understand is that garage door cost depends on what you're doing. A spring repair isn't a panel replacement, and a full door installation is a different beast entirely. Your material choice, door size, and whether you need same-day service all factor in.
A single torsion spring replacement typically runs $200 to $400 in the Norwalk area. That's parts plus labor. If both springs are shot (and they usually wear together), you're looking at $400 to $600. Springs last about 7 to 9 years, not 10, so don't be shocked if they fail sooner than you expected. A basic garage door panel repair costs between $150 and $350, depending on damage severity. A dented panel on a standard single-car door is cheaper than fixing damage on an oversized commercial unit.
Door replacement is where pricing jumps. A new single-car garage door with installation typically costs $800 to $2,000. A double-car door runs $1,200 to $3,000. These ranges vary based on insulation level (basic, standard, or premium), material (steel, aluminum, wood composite), and custom sizing. Insulated doors cost more upfront but save energy, especially here on Connecticut's coast where winters bite hard.
Opener replacement adds another $300 to $800 depending on the model you choose. Chain drives are budget-friendly. Belt drives run quieter. How to Get an Honest Quote
When you call for an estimate, reputable contractors ask specific questions. What's the issue? What's your door type? Is it steel or wood? Single or double? They don't throw a number at you over the phone without looking at the actual situation first. That's how you end up surprised on the bill.

Request quotes from at least two or three local companies. Compare apples to apples: same parts, same labor scope, same warranty. If one quote is half the price of others, ask why. Sometimes it's because they're cutting corners or using lower-quality parts.
Emergency service costs more. If your door breaks at 10 p.m. on a Sunday, expect a surcharge. Routine Monday morning repairs don't carry that premium. If emergency garage door service in Norwalk becomes necessary, budget an extra $150 to $250 beyond the standard repair price.
What About Maintenance to Prevent Big Bills
Preventive maintenance is the smartest investment you can make. An annual inspection costs $75 to $150. You'll catch worn springs, fraying cables, and worn rollers before they fail catastrophically. Replacing one cable now beats replacing both plus the door panel after it slams to the ground.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does a basic garage door repair cost in Norwalk? Basic repairs like spring replacement, panel fixes, or cable adjustments run $150 to $600 depending on what fails. Springs are typically $200 to $400. Always get a written quote before work begins to avoid surprises.
What's the average cost to replace an entire garage door? A new door with installation typically costs $800 to $2,000 for single-car, $1,200 to $3,000 for double-car. Insulated doors and premium materials cost more but last longer and improve home value.
Is emergency garage door service more expensive? Yes. After-hours emergency calls carry surcharges of $150 to $250 above standard repair costs. Daytime and next-day service appointments typically don't include emergency fees.
Should I repair my old door or replace it? If repairs exceed 50 percent of replacement cost, replacement usually makes sense. Doors older than 15 years are candidates for replacement. We'll advise honestly during your free estimate.
